are there any springs on the market that lowers 1'?? 1' or little less, not those .5' ones, I want to have it low but not have to scrape my front lip all the time going up a ramp.
So far I know that,
Neuspeed - 1.25
KGMM - .5 and 1.35??
HKS - 2
H&R -??
MGracing - 1.5
anything else??

i've tried both H&R and KG/MM.
i found the H&R to be too soft (for my driving style, anyway)
so i replaced them with KG/MM's - a little firmer than stock/H&R's but that in turn provides much flatter cornering and reduced body roll - i love 'em. i have a hardtop, so the "tightness" is even more pronounced.
i did the swap a few months ago and the drop has now settled to about an inch and a half.
the H&R's had settled to about an inch.
i have 18's so the additional "drop", also tucks in the rear wheels (neg. camber) better as well.
the car looks hot and handles really well for what you end up spending ($250US, i think) - i consider this to be one of those "good upgrades" in my opinion.
i'm going to complement the KG/MM's with Koni yellows shortly...
